ARSENAL travel to the Spanish capital for the second leg of their Champions League quarter-final with Real Madrid TONIGHT.

Declan Rice was the star of the show at the Emirates last week, scoring TWO spectacular free-kicks as the Gunners stunned Los Blancos with a 3-0 win in the first leg.

Real Madrid will be eyeing a historic comeback at the Bernabeu, with the likes of Kylian Mbappe, Jude Bellingham and Vinicius Junior leading the way for the 15-time Champions League winners.

However, the Spanish giants will need to do something they haven’t done since 1985, and overturn a 3-0 aggregate deficit in a European competition, if they are to make the semi-final.
